Keg Creek Trailhead – Parking Area offers nature lovers and pet owners a beautiful destination in Appling, Georgia. While not a traditional fenced dog park, this site serves as a gateway to pet-friendly trails, perfect for dog-friendly hiking experiences. It’s a local favorite for those seeking outdoor adventures with their furry friends in the Augusta region, providing easy access to natural landscapes and recreational paths.

The parking area is conveniently located and provides direct access to Keg Creek’s scenic hiking trails where leashed dogs are welcome. While there may not be dedicated dog park amenities such as fenced play areas, water fountains, or agility equipment, the park’s primary appeal is its natural setting and proximity to Lake Thurmond. It is ideal for owners who enjoy hiking or exploring with their dogs. Plan for your pet’s needs—carry water, waste bags, and any other essentials for a comfortable outing.

Anthony Bishop

Real good trail if you’re looking for a long one. You will hear the highway for about 30 minutes into the trail but it quiets down. Ran into about 7-8 real muddy spots where I had to go into the brush to get around. Theres a few creek crossings and around mile 5-6 I had to get my ankles wet because the lake came up over the trail. Once you come out on the other side at the road there is plenty of space on the bridge to walk back to the car without crowding up next to traffic. Highly recommend if you want a moderate hike to take up a couple of hours.
